Event Details

The 26th Advanced Automotive Battery Conference (AABC) 2026 is a four-day battery technology and automotive electrification event taking place from 7 to 10 December 2026 at the San Diego Convention Center in San Diego, California, United States. Established more than 25 years ago, AABC brings together automotive OEMs, battery developers, materials companies, manufacturers, researchers, and technology suppliers to examine the technical and commercial developments shaping the future of electric vehicle batteries. The 2026 programme features 150 speakers from organisations including Ford, General Motors, Tesla, Toyota, Stellantis, Nissan, QuantumScape, Siemens, Fluence, and Argonne National Laboratory.


Purpose and Objectives


The primary purpose of AABC is to review the current state of automotive battery technology and provide informed insight into the future direction of vehicle electrification. The event focuses on battery performance, chemistry, manufacturing, engineering, raw materials, recycling, and commercialisation while connecting OEM battery teams with suppliers and technology developers working on next-generation energy storage.


Key Activities


The programme includes visionary keynotes, industry case studies, panel discussions, technical conferences, hands-on tutorials, poster sessions, and networking. Dedicated tracks cover lithium battery chemistry, battery engineering, high-performance battery manufacturing, global battery raw materials, xEV battery technology, manufacturing production, AI for energy storage, and large-scale recycling. OEM and battery developer presentations also address solid-state batteries, battery recycling, cell longevity, pack architecture, manufacturing scale-up, and advanced battery materials.


Significance


AABC is significant because it connects the scientific development of battery technologies directly with the requirements of automotive manufacturers and commercial-scale production. Its long-running focus on vehicle electrification gives participants access to battery roadmaps from major OEMs alongside advances from cell developers, materials suppliers, equipment companies, and research institutions. This makes the event particularly relevant for understanding where automotive battery technology and manufacturing are moving next.


Expected Outcomes


Participants can expect stronger understanding of emerging battery chemistries, manufacturing technologies, EV battery requirements, supply-chain developments, and recycling strategies. The conference is intended to support technical collaboration, supplier relationships, technology evaluation, research exchange, and commercial partnerships between automotive manufacturers and companies developing the next generation of battery technologies.
